c. 1970, Gujrat
Handcrafted in Gujarat around the 1970s, this charming flip-back swing is a fine example of traditional Indian craftsmanship with a touch of ingenuity. Designed with a practical mechanism that allows the seat to flip, it combines function with artistry, making it both versatile and enduring.
The swing is crafted from solid wood, with time-worn surfaces and a natural patina that speaks to decades of use and heritage. Its form reflects the cultural significance of swings in Gujarati households—symbols of leisure, comfort, and community.
Now, restored and ready for contemporary living, it serves as a statement piece for verandahs, living spaces, or patios, blending nostalgia with everyday utility.
